EXPOSITION PARK : Globetrotters to Be Honored
The Harlem Globetrotters and the late Fred Snowden are among the honorees being inducted into the Black Sports Hall of Fame at an Afro-American Museum ceremony Thursday.
Curly Neal will retire his Globetrotter jersey and donate it to the Black Sports Hall of Fame. Neal and Snowden, the former executive director of the Food 4 Less Foundation, will be honored for their contributions to the community and basketball.
